Breaking: Former President Muhammadu Buhari passes on in London hospital
Nigeria is in mourning following the passing of its immediate past President, Muhammadu Buhari, who died on Sunday afternoon in a London hospital after a prolonged illness. He was 82.
TETFund sets up committee to select varsities for mechanised agric scheme
The Tertiary Education Trust Fund (TETFund) has inaugurated a five-member committee to select 10 Nigerian universities for the establishment of mechanised commercial farms and livestock operations under its 2025 intervention.
